Understand the Immediate Aftermath

Right after an Endolift session, you might notice mild swelling, redness, or a tingling sensation in the treated area. This is completely normal and typically subsides within a few hours to a couple of days. It’s your body’s way of responding to the energy delivered under the skin.

Don’t panic if the results aren’t immediately visible—Endolift works beneath the surface, and the full effects often unfold gradually over several weeks as collagen production ramps up.

Quick Tip: Use a cold compress (not ice directly on the skin) to reduce initial swelling and discomfort.

Keep It Clean and Simple

Cleanliness is key during recovery. Stick to gentle cleansers and lukewarm water when washing the treated area. Avoid exfoliating products, retinoids, or acids for at least a week post-procedure. Your skin is in a sensitive state, and harsh ingredients can do more harm than good.

What to use instead: A fragrance-free, hypoallergenic cleanser and a mild moisturizer that won’t clog pores or irritate your skin.

Skip the Workout (Just for a Bit)

While you may feel fine physically, it’s best to avoid intense workouts, saunas, or any activity that increases body heat and sweating for the first 48 to 72 hours. These can increase swelling or irritation in the treated area and potentially slow your recovery.

Walking or light stretching is perfectly fine—and even encouraged—but save your high-intensity routines for later.

Sunscreen is Non-Negotiable

Your skin becomes more vulnerable to UV rays post-treatment. Unprotected sun exposure can lead to pigmentation issues or even reduce the effectiveness of your Endolift results. A broad-spectrum sunscreen with at least SPF 30 is a must, even if you’re mostly indoors or it’s cloudy.

Pro tip: Reapply every two hours if you’re outdoors, and wear a hat or use physical barriers like umbrellas when possible.

Patience Pays Off

Unlike instant cosmetic fixes, Endolift is a slow burn. You’ll begin to see improvements in contour and texture within a few weeks, but the real magic happens over time—often 2 to 3 months after treatment. Be patient and allow your skin the time it needs to regenerate.

In the meantime, you can support the process by maintaining a healthy diet, getting quality sleep, and avoiding alcohol and smoking, which can compromise collagen production.
